Rosalyn Durant, ESPN executive vice president, programming & acquisitions, leads programming, media rights deals, ESPN+, ESPN International, Andscape, and espnW. Durant spent the past three years in Orlando as senior vice president of Disney Springs, Water Parks and ESPN Wide World of Sports.

While at the parks, she oversaw Disney Springs, Walt Disney World’s shopping, dining, and entertainment destination; both Walt Disney World water parks; the resort’s sports operations, including ESPN Wide World of Sports complex; and the workforce management, operations training, and business transformation teams. She took on the role in March 2020 and played a critical role in helping restart the 2019-20 NBA season in the “Bubble” at ESPN Wide World of Sports during the pandemic. Before her stint with Disney Parks, Durant most recently served as senior vice president of ESPN’s College Networks, overseeing ESPNU, SEC Network, and Longhorn Network, and was a central member of the cross-functional leadership team that successfully launched the ACC Network.

Durant graduated in 1999 from the University of South Carolina with a bachelor’s degree in Broadcast Journalism and a minor in Marketing.
